Abstract

The present invention relates to a composite precise bar material shearing machine and a composite shearing method thereof. The composite precise bar material shearing machine comprises a composite shearing depth adjusting part, a clamping and shearing part, a pushing, clamping and loosening part, and a crank composite shearing part. Because the present invention adopts a composite shearing method, bar materials are sheared after being clamped by an upper cutter and a lower cutter. Because of being clamped by the upper cutter and the lower cutter, the bar materials can not bend during shearing. Therefore, the bar materials almost have no compression degree, and shearing sections are relatively vertical. The preshearing depth of the product is about from 1/3 to 3/4 of the shearing depth. When preshearing is finished, a slide block runs towards a reverse direction and enters a shearing area, so the bar materials can be superposed with the preshearing area easily. Therefore, the shearing sections are vertical, and the core parts of the bar materials can not be torn.

Description

Compound cutting machine of bar and combination shearing method thereof
The present invention relates to compound cutting machine of a kind of bar and combination shearing method thereof.
Carrying out sheared blank at present both at home and abroad all is to adopt unidirectional cutting method, and shearing section flattening degree is big, and non-perpendicularity is big, and the bar core is torn phenomenon, influences quality and next procedure.
The purpose of this invention is to provide a kind of compound cutting machine of bar and combination shearing method thereof that adopts combination shearing method to shear bar.
For achieving the above object, technical scheme of the present invention is: the compound cutting machine of a kind of bar, comprise combination shearing degree of depth adjustment member, clamp and cutting out section, promote to clamp and unclamp part, crank combination shearing part, it is characterized in that: adjust wedge (2) and be installed on the slide block (1) by guide rail, deciding wedge (3) is fixed on the framework (4), bottom knife (5) is fixed on the framework (4), cutter (6) is fixed on the small slide block (15), small slide block (15) is connected on the framework (4) by guide rail, deciding wedge (7) is fixed on the small slide block (15), moving wedge (8) is connected by guide rail to be decided on the wedge (7), tooth bar (9) is fixed on the moving wedge (8), tooth bar (11) is fixed on the moving wedge (12), moving wedge (12) is connected by guide rail to be decided on the wedge (13), decides wedge (13) and is fixed on the framework (4), and crank (14) is contained in the quadrel (16), quadrel (16) is contained in the square hole of slide block (1), and gear (10) is contained on the support of framework (4).Its combination shearing method is: at first rotated by gear (10) up time, drive and decide wedge (8), moving wedge (12) upper and lower displacement, move to left and promote small slide block (15), simultaneously framework (4) has trace to move to right bar is clamped, when crank (14) inverse time direction rotating band movable slider (1) moves to right, at first pass through transition gap (17) afterwards, slide block (1) moves to right, driving framework (4) moves to right, rotate to 0 °, the pre-shearing ended, when crank (14) rotation by 0 ° when being rotated counterclockwise for 180 °, then that sheared blank is disconnected.
The present invention is because of adopting combination shearing method, bar is sheared after upper and lower cutter clamps, because of upper and lower cutter clamps, bar is not crooked when shearing, because of so the not crooked bar of bar does not almost have the flattening degree, so the shearing section is more vertical, be the double direction shear structure because of adopting combination shearing in addition, the preshearing degree of depth is about the shearing degree of depth of 1/3-3/4, and when pre-shearing end of a period, slide block is to reverse direction operation, then enter and cut off the zone, bar is easily overlapped along the share zone of preshearing,, and the bar core is not torn so the shearing section is vertical.
